在互联网时代,用户体验是网站和应用程序成功的关键。滑动前端框架的出现,无疑为用户带来了颠覆性的交互体验。本文将深入探讨滑动前端框架的革新之道,分析其背后的技术原理和应用场景。
一、滑动前端框架概述
滑动前端框架是指基于HTML、CSS和JavaScript等技术,实现页面或组件内容通过滑动操作进行切换或展示的一系列框架。这类框架具有操作简单、响应速度快、交互体验丰富等特点,广泛应用于移动端和桌面端应用中。
二、滑动前端框架的技术原理
响应式设计:滑动前端框架通常采用响应式设计,能够根据不同设备屏幕尺寸和分辨率自动调整布局和滑动效果,保证用户在不同设备上获得一致的体验。
触摸事件监听:框架通过监听触摸事件(如touchstart、touchmove、touchend),实现用户触摸屏幕时的滑动操作。
滚动容器:滑动框架通常包含一个滚动容器,用于承载滑动内容。容器可以通过CSS样式设置固定高度和宽度,确保滑动内容在滑动过程中不会超出容器范围。
动画效果:滑动框架支持丰富的动画效果,如平移、缩放、旋转等,为用户带来更丰富的视觉体验。
性能优化:滑动框架采用多种性能优化技术,如懒加载、预加载等,提高滑动操作的流畅度和响应速度。
三、滑动前端框架的应用场景
移动端应用:滑动前端框架在移动端应用中应用广泛,如新闻资讯、电商、社交平台等,为用户带来流畅的滑动浏览体验。
桌面端应用:桌面端应用如网页浏览器、办公软件等,也可以采用滑动前端框架实现内容切换和展示。
网页设计:滑动前端框架可以用于网页设计,实现图片轮播、视频播放、产品展示等功能。
交互式游戏:滑动前端框架可以应用于交互式游戏,为玩家提供丰富的滑动操作和游戏体验。
四、滑动前端框架的优势
提升用户体验:滑动前端框架通过丰富的交互效果和流畅的滑动操作,提升用户在使用网站或应用程序时的满意度。
降低开发成本:滑动前端框架提供丰富的组件和插件,开发者可以快速构建出功能强大的应用,降低开发成本。
提高开发效率:滑动前端框架简化了开发流程,开发者可以专注于业务逻辑,提高开发效率。
适应性强:滑动前端框架支持多种设备和平台,具有较好的适应性。
五、滑动前端框架的挑战
性能优化:滑动前端框架在实现丰富交互效果的同时,对性能提出了更高要求。开发者需要关注性能优化,确保滑动操作的流畅度。
兼容性问题:不同浏览器和设备对滑动前端框架的支持程度不同,开发者需要关注兼容性问题,确保应用在不同环境中正常运行。
用户体验一致性:滑动前端框架需要保证在不同设备和平台上的用户体验一致性,避免因滑动效果差异导致用户困惑。
总之,滑动前端框架以其颠覆性的交互体验和丰富的应用场景,成为前端开发的重要工具。开发者应关注滑动前端框架的技术原理和应用场景,充分发挥其优势,为用户提供更好的体验。
